O₂ is one of the most critical variables in the physical world — shaping freshness, safety, efficiency, and stability across global systems. When you can measure oxygen with precision, you unlock control over processes that move billions of products and impact millions of lives.
O₂ drives freshness, shelf life, and quality across the entire food and beverage supply chain.

O₂ data protects patients and improves outcomes across respiratory care, wound care, and diagnostics.

O₂ determines stability, yield, and safety in combustion, fermentation, and chemical production processes.

Precise O₂ control enables reliable performance in fuel cells, electrolysers, and next-generation energy systems.

Compact O₂ sensing powers new applications in personal health, safety, and continuous monitoring.

Any system influenced by oxygen becomes a platform for innovation when accurate, scalable O₂ sensing is available.
